The pull operation is used for synchronization between two repository instances. Pull operation copies the changes from a remote repository instance to the local repository. Whenever you make a commit, HEAD is updated with the latest commit. Every branch is referenced by HEAD, which points to the latest commit in the branch. Once the feature is completed, it is merged back with the master branch and we delete the branch.
